## Idempotency Keys for Payment Retries (Lumopay)

Every retry of a charge request must reuse the original idempotency key; generating a new key on retry can produce duplicate charges. Keys are scoped per merchant and expire after 48 hours. Reviewers should verify keys are derived server-side, never from client input. The full key-generation specification and threat model are maintained on the internal page.

dashboard of kaguf-tawip = https://vault.merlaqsys.test/issue

The nightly import pulls the Bramblefield library consortium's catalogue export, normalises MARC-ish records into our schema, and flags duplicates for librarian review rather than auto-merging — that decision was deliberate after early mishaps. The import is idempotent; rerunning a failed night is safe. Watch the dedupe threshold: lowering it floods the review queue. Logs rotate weekly and the failure alert goes to the catalogue channel. The importer currently runs with the following configuration values.

settings of bawif-fawif:
ralix:
  log_level: warn
  metrics_host: metrics.ralix.tolvaqsys.internal
  pool_size: 32

Plugin authors should never delete objects directly; instead, submit an archive manifest to the Coldpath service, which validates checksums, applies the retention ledger, and moves data to glacier-tier storage in the Harrowfen region. Manifests exceeding 10,000 entries must be chunked. Failed transfers are retried twice before the bucket is flagged for manual review by the Tidemark operations crew. All Coldpath requests require authentication against the internal gateway, and the key to use for sandbox testing appears below.

app token of bawep-hafog = kto7_vwrmnlx

Hi, and welcome to the Profilium on-call rotation. The user-profile store is sharded by account hash across twelve segments; rebalances are automated but occasionally stall, which pages you. Most incidents resolve by resuming the migrator — do not manually move shards. Future maintainers have documented every known failure mode and the recovery commands on the internal runbook page here.

wiki page, tahaf-tajog: https://jira.ordindyn.corp/pipeline